Pixie Organic Cotton Cloth Menstrual Pads offer a reusable, eco-friendly alternative to disposable pads with a certified organic cotton top layer free from toxins and chemicals. Featuring double snap wings for a secure fit and a breathable five-layer design, these pads provide reliable regular absorbency while minimizing odors and irritation. Machine washable and including a convenient wet bag, they combine comfort, sustainability, and practicality for conscious consumers.

Good-bye, regular pads!
I love these. Great price considering the longevity of them! I used to buy organic cotton single-use pads, and it can get pretty pricey. I also didnt like how the single-use pads would slide around and get shifted, with or without wings. (Many pairs of underwear/shorts/ pants/ skorts have been ruined because of pads squishing and moving around.) Enter these reusable ones: In an effort to be more eco-friendly and less wasteful, I decided that these pads would be my last purchase for a long while. I’m thrilled to say theyre comfy, very soft, low profile, dont shift like the single-use pads, theyre leak-proof, easy to wash, and it’s easy to fold the used ones and button them. My one caveat: I don’t like the bag it comes with. It feels cheap in comparison to the pads, but I use a separate organic cotton bag to keep them in. I also think a dual-compartment bag would be such a good idea. One compartment for the clean pads, and one compartment for the used ones. Also, please know that they will not look as pretty as they first do when you buy them. They will get staining, no matter how vigilant you are. I keep a spray bottle of hydrogen peroxide in my laundry room and bathroom to spray them after usage. Then, I will throw them into my next load of whites (or darks) and yes, I do machine-dry them. I have zero issues doing this, but they also air-dry flat quickly, as well. If youre looking for a good alternative without the chemicals, these are it. I love them and don’t miss my old pads at all. I keep single-use pads for guests, just in case, but theyre not something I use. Tips: -Buy more than one 5-pack! I have two of the 5-packs, and might get a third depending on how my flow is next month! -Learn which way you like to fold them and button them. That way, when theyre used, it’s easier to store them for later washing. Unbutton before you throw in the wash. -Hydrogen peroxide like I mentioned above. A spray form is what I use to generously douse before throwing in the wet bag, or in the washer. Helps remove blood stains. Overall, Picky Girl approved!!

Comfortable and durable!
These are great. I recently made the switch away from disposable products (to include reusable pads and also period underwear) and I find these to be an excellent addition to my system. On my heavier days, I layer one over period underwear to extend the wear of the panties. They're very comfortable and do a good job of keeping me feeling dry. The side backside has little grippies that keep them from sliding around. Kudos to another reviewer who suggested flipping them backwards and wearing the back to front-- those fit underwear much better that way and feel much more comfortable. I also appreciate the little wet bag they come with for travel. My one issue is the staining. Although I rinse right away, soak in cold water, and do a double wash (once with water and once with soap), I do end up with some staining. I started using oxyclean on the stains and that has been effective. Overall, I'd buy them again.

Fantastic, what a relief!
About a year ago my skin became very sensitive to many of my usual cosmetics, clothes, underwear and even disposable pads. It got to the point where I had to discard everything and start again. I started searching for a solution to disposable pads and was surprised to find so many reusable ones. Unfortunately, many of them had a fleece liner which I have also reacted too. I came across a UK company that sold cotton pads but they were out of stock and did not know when they would be available again. I did however, purchase a dedicated soak box for reusable pads from them. I then looked again and came across these cotton cloth pads from the Pixie Cup Store, on Amazon. What a delight! No dye, no fleece, no microfiber, just pure white cotton next to my skin. Fantastic. They have a waterproof base that does not touch my skin. I ended up getting two packs, one of the mini's and one of the medium size. I do prefer the mini's because the medium are a bit longer and sometimes fold over at the end when putting them on, it's easy enough to straighten them out though. Having said that, both packs are useful because they both work with different flows. They are easy to keep clean. I soak them immediately after using them, in the dedicated pad, wash box. I pop a bundle together in a laundry bag, and then the washing machine, on a cool cycle if soaking has not been enough. I sometimes dry them on low for a short while in the dryer, and air dry them further till I can put them away. I am so happy with these pads. They are comfortable, gentle against my skin and have solved the issue I had with disposable pads. They are also much better for the environment.
